Hi Peter

First of all, thanks for showing enthusiasm in hepling GIMP UI wise.

It seems however that you have not noticed the UI progress that has been
put into GIMP through the work of mailny Peter Sikking. In fact, several
UI related specifications has been written by Peter Sikking and
implemented by the core developers.

I suggest you check out the UI wiki [1] to get a view of the current
GIMP UI state, and then coordinate with the existing UI people.

Regarding multiple UIs, the big problem with that is that it multiplies
the required efforts in several areas: coding, documentation, knowledge
when giving help, and so on.
